You could use puppet or ansible or tool of your choice to lookup the DNS entry and populate /etc/sysconfig/slurmd on your compute with the correct Slurmctld record before you start slurm.

Format of etc/sysconfig/slurmd is like this:

SLURMD\_OPTIONS="--conf-server slurmctl-primary:6817,slurmctl-backup"

I have owned a T490 since 2020, the one thing I did not like about it was the trackpad, I replaced it with this https://www.aliexpress.us/item/2255800411353612.html which is a glass trackpad from the X1. I was inspired by this posting, and found it more responsive.

What I suggest doing is replace the trackpad (search the forums for issues some people had with Windows drivers) and add more RAM. You have one Memory DIMM soldered to the motherboard, it will either be 8GB or 16GB DIMM, you can add a 32GB DIMM which will give you a total of 40GB or 48GB of RAM which may extend the life of your laptop by 1 - 5 years. You could also replace the SSD with a larger drive. It's up to you if spending $100 - $200 upgrade the components or saving that money to buy a newer laptop is worth it.
